Galobki Cabbage Rolls Recipe

Ingredients
  • Cabbage Rolls:
  • 1 lb. hamburger
  • ⅜ to ½ cup cooked rice
  • 1 egg
  • I medium head of cabbage
  • Sauce:
  • 1 tsp. Real Lemon
  • ¼ tsp ground ginger
  • 1 tsp. paprika
  • ¼ tsp. marjoram
  • ¼ tsp. dill weed
  • 3 cans tomato soup
  • 1 soup can water
  • 1 Tbsp. bacon bits
  • 2 Tbsp. Worcestershire Sauce
  • ¼ cup red wine vinegar
  • 1 Tbsp. dried minced onion
  • 1 Tbsp. minced garlic
  • 2 tsp. sugar
  • ¼ tsp. crushed red pepper seeds
  • ¼ tsp. ground cloves
  • ¼ tsp. nutmeg
  • 1 tsp. salt

Directions
  1. Combine all sauce ingredients in a mixing bowl.
  2. Combine hamburger, rice and egg in a mixing bowl then add about ⅓ of the sauce mixture and mix thoroughly.
  3. Remove the core from the cabbage and place in a pot of boiling water until the leaves seperate easily.
  4. Place approximately 1 to 2 Tbsp. of meat mixture in the center of each leaf and roll, tucking in edges to seal the roll. Place finished rolls in lightly greased baking dish.
  5. Pour the remaining sauce mixture over the rolls, cover and bake at 350° for about an hour then uncover long enough to allow the sauce to thicken and lightly brown the tops of the rolls.
